The focus of these drills is on football fundamentals, specifically–basic blocking. The blocking drills are step by step drills to learn the proper position, stance and principles with blocking.

If these principles become an everyday part of practice, play calling and blocking roles are easily explained even at the most basic level.

Blocking Drills:
Blocking position:   Catcher’s stance into 3 pt (25% of wt on hand), on go both arms load position (starting a lawn mower), eyes up on target, move per blocking drill, unload arms in contact with defense.

1.   Drive Block Left–Straight ahead, Right shoulder, Left foot power step forward 6″, contact unload drive forward
2.   Drive Block Right–Straight ahead, Left shoulder, Right foot power step forward 6″, contact unload drive forward
3.   Quick Left–Closing the gap, quick 6″ step left, right shoulder, contact unload drive forward
4.   Quick Right–Closing the gap, quick 6″ step right, left shoulder, contact unload drive forward
5.   Wide Left–Blocking defense lined up wide left, right shoulder wide step left back angled 45 degrees, cross over step, square up, contact unload drive forward
6.   Wide Right–Blocking defense lined up wide right, left shoulder wide step right back angled 45 degrees, cross over step, square up, contact unload drive forward
7.   Down Left–Drive block one position over step left and forward at 45 degree angle, contact unload drive forward.
8.   Down Right–Drive block on position over step right and forward at 45 degree angle, contact unload drive forward.
9.   Pull / Trap Left–Rotate body 90 degrees back picking up left foot and pivoting on right foot, release to pull block down the line.
10.   Pull / Trap Right–Rotate body 90 degrees back picking up right foot and pivoting on left foot, release to pull block down the line.

All of these drills are progressive.   The coach has each move executed and critiqued on each whistle blow.   Once understood, the techniques are executed on one whistle.
